About Zara

•Founded- 1975

•Headquarters- A Coruña,Spain

•Industry- Retail

•Products- Clothing

•Parent- Inditex Group

•Founder- Amancio Ortega

• CEO- Pablo Isla Álvarez de

Tejera.

The Zara’s concept 

• Zara´s aim, according toAmancio Ortega,founder of Inditex, is to democratize fashion by

offering the latest fashionin medium quality ataffordable prices.

• What differentiates Zara´s

business model from thatof its competitors is theturn around time and thestore as a source of 

information.

• Zara’s vertical integration of design, just-in-time

manufacturing system, deliveryand sales; flexible structure,lowinventory rule; quick response

policy and advanced information technology all combined toenable quick response tocustomer’s changing demands. 

• Changes of an existing garmentcan be put on display withintwo weeks, much faster thanthe competition

Store Analysis

• The interiors are designed to create a uniqueatmosphere and with attractive window displays.

• The firm spends only 0.3 percent of its annualturnover on advertising, normally at thebeginning of sales season or the occasions of newstore opening.

• The store is considered its most effectivecommunication tool.

• Zara continuously adapts to market demands,aiming to deliver a unique service to thecustomer

• Zara´s promotion strategy is the same in the

domestic and foreign markets. Advertisementcampaigns are carried out only at the start of sales or a new store opening. Zara relies onthe store as its main promotional tool.

• The company uses the name of the firm and aunique brand name for the same productgroup. Examples of these sub-brands are `Zara

Woman´, `Zara Basic´ and `Zara Trafaluc’.

Window display

• Minimalistic closed window display .

• Plain background zara’s brand name.

• Attention seeker- uniquely stylizedmannequins that bring out the designs andattract customers .

• creative freedom in the look of the

mannequins at this store• Pay more attention towards highlighting

garment rather then the theme.
